August 19, 1969: Signed by the Chicago White Sox as an amateur free agent.

December 5, 1977: Traded by the Chicago White Sox with Dave Frost and Chris Knapp to the California Angels for Bobby Bonds, Thad Bosley and Richard Dotson.

November 12, 1986: Granted Free Agency.

January 8, 1987: Signed as a Free Agent with the California Angels.

November 5, 1990: Granted Free Agency.

April 13, 1991: Signed as a Free Agent with the Texas Rangers.

October 30, 1991: Granted Free Agency.

December 7, 1991: Signed as a Free Agent with the Texas Rangers.

November 6, 1992: Granted Free Agency.
